Stop At: Sergiy Korolyov Astronautics Museum, Ivana Franka vul. 22, Zhytomyr 10008 Ukraine
Cosmos museum in Zhytomyr is one of the best of its kind in the world. It was opened in 1987 next to memorial house of Sergyi Korolyov – the inventor of the engine and rocket that took Gagarin in to the space. The exhibition contains many originals, including landing capsules of soviet astronauts, their space food, suites, photos etc. There temporary exhibitions as well.

Stop At: Korostyshiv Mines, Korostyshiv Ukraine
Korostyshiv granite quarry is both natural and artificial attraction. This quarry is known from 1850 and black labradorite was mined here in 1920s here for Lenin mausoleum in Moscow. Since 1990s the quarry is closed and filled with water that is very deep (up to 20 meters) and clean here. The walls of the quarry are very steep and covered with picturesque pines.
